[Bug 1933714] [NEW] webfrontend does not render correctly due to wrong paths
Public bug reported: This refers to prometheus-pushgateway 1.4.0+ds-1 and seems to be an issue specifically with dpkg package and not an upstream issue. After installation accessing http://localhost:9091 renders a garbled page. Using web developer it's obvious that some resources don't exist in `/usr/share/prometheus/pushgateway/static`, see screenshot attached. Specifically 2 things are wrong: 1) `/usr/share/prometheus/pushgateway/static/bootstrap4` is there, but it's referred as `bootstrap-4` (note the dash). I've worked around this by: ``` cd /usr/share/prometheus/pushgateway/static ln -s ../../../javascript/bootstrap4 bootstrap-4 ``` 2) `/usr/share/prometheus/pushgateway/static/jquery.min.js` is missing. Workaround: ``` cd /usr/share/prometheus/pushgateway/static ln -s jquery/jquery.min.js jquery.min.js ``` With these changes everything works fine. [Bug 1857775] Re: dmesg/syslog flooded with: iwlwifi 0000:00:14.3: Unhandled alg: 0x707
I'm also suffering from this. As a workaround adding `options iwlwifi 11n_disable=1` to `/etc/modprobe.d/iwlwifi.conf` helped for me. -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Bugs, which is subscribed to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1857775 Title: dmesg/syslog flooded with: iwlwifi :00:14.3: Unhandled alg: 0x707 To manage notifications about this bug go to: https://bugs.launchpad.net/linux/+bug/1857775/+subscriptions -- ubuntu-bugs mailing list ubuntu-bugs@lists.ubuntu.com https://lists.ubuntu.com/mailman/listinfo/ubuntu-bugs
